Carbide-mediated catalytic hydrogenolysis: defects in graphene on a carbonaceous lithium host for liquid and all-solid-state lithium metal batteries
Namhyung Kim, Hyungyeon Cha, Sujong Chae, Tae Yong Lee, Yoon‐Kwang Lee, Yu-Jin Kim, Jaekyung Sung, Jaephil Cho
Abstract
Reaction pathway of isothermal growth of defective graphene shell on Fe catalyst by the carbide-mediated catalytic hydrogenolysis. This defective graphene shell promotes a reversible Li plating/stripping behavior.
